Affordability vs median income
Modeled annual costs equal about 112.4% of median family income in Bronx County, NY and 57.6% in Chautauqua County, NY. This matters because a cheaper county can still feel tight if typical local incomes are also lower.
Housing
Housing is $14,523 per year lower in Chautauqua County, NY than in Bronx County, NY. Housing usually behaves like a fixed monthly commitment, so this matters most for renters or buyers checking whether Chautauqua County, NY changes their baseline budget.

Transportation
Transportation is $6,402 per year higher in Chautauqua County, NY than in Bronx County, NY. Transportation matters for commuters because driving distance, vehicle costs, and transit access can change how much of a salary is left after getting around Chautauqua County, NY.
